Hi all. Just new to this site
Was wondering is there any way of fixing a broken air vent in a radiator . can you buy a kit or anything? The vent is quite small at the back of the radiator. thanks
 
New radiator.

By the time you take the radiator out, drill it out, manage to get the last of the bleed vent and try to clean the threads up only to realise the spare gets stuck or doesnt fit.

youve wasted a load of time and money.
better to get a nice sniney new one and fit it
 
Best option is dont bother - unless your really unlucky the air in this rad will get pumped around to another radiator which you can vent Centralheatking :96:
 
Last edited by a moderator:
Use to drill and re-tap rad vents on myson rads to save money when I use to work for BGas ... ones on the side. However I totally agree with above... Not worth the effort unless you're skint!! :)
 
Funnily enough, I've got one of these booked in for Wednesday.

Rad off, lay it flat, sharp tap with centre punch, 3mm hole and an easy-out. Job's a good 'un...
